The charity supports children and young people, elderly people, people with disabilities, other charities or voluntary bodies, and the general public. Derwentside Trust is a registered charity whose purpose is general charitable purposes. It delivers its work by providing human resources. The charity is based in Consett and operates in Durham.

Activities & Mission

The charity runs and delivers local voluntary and community activities. The charity runs a local building, namely Glenroyd House in Consett, County Durham. This provides provision for a number of local and community activities such as food bank, counselling services, sexual health clinics, drug and alcohol centre and job search clubs. We also have rooms for public use for training, meetings etc.
